Italian Circular Slit Spectrometer Set for Spain Eclipse Test

Validation of the new optical design would enable much faster, full-corona spectral mapping and guide plans for a future space instrument.

Overview

  • Researchers will operate the Circular Slit Spectrometer (CISS) during the total solar eclipse on Wednesday, August 12, at the Javalambre Astrophysical Observatory in Spain to perform a decisive on-sky test.
  • CISS uses a circular slit to capture the spectrum of the entire solar corona at a fixed radius in a single photograph, a change from conventional linear slits that scan the corona line by line.
  • The team finished final laboratory work in Padua and transported the assembled prototype by road to Spain to avoid disassembly and flight delays, stressing that precise timing and good weather are essential for the brief totality window.
  • If the prototype proves the optical principle, scientists say the technique could be adapted for a spaceborne spectrometer to monitor the corona more continuously, replacing slow multi-hour scans such as those done by UVCS on SOHO.
  • Results from the August 12 observation are pending and will determine whether CISS can deliver minute-scale spectral maps of coronal changes and thus improve early warning of solar effects on communications and power systems on Earth.
